There’s a huge difference between a competing service (Uber vs. Lyft , Southwest vs. United Airlines, etc.) and ripping off a design (like Gucci vs. DHgate). Uber just happened to have been the first to market for something of their type and the two companies do actively try to differentiate themselves from each other where as people who are buying Gucci replicas are trying to pass them off as the real deal. Sure Lyft might have copied the original business idea but this is different than Lyft calling themselves L-Uber and using similar branding and ripping off the Uber app exactly. This situation is somewhere in the middle. Designers take inspiration from other designers all the time, it’s more just how they change the item to make it their own that is more important. Some things are pretty basic (for example the Hermès Oran sandals) so it’s hard to put too much of your own spin on it so it becomes more about changing the look of the sole, the materials, colours, etc. Definitely still a grey area but I agree that the people who are buying the Steve Madden look alike of this sandal probably weren’t going to buy the Hermès version. Personally I think that as long as you’re not trying to pass it off as the real deal then it’s not so bad. I do have issues with people getting replica Chanel bags with the logos and all and trying to pretend it’s the real deal. I haven’t dove too deep into DB’s pendant vs the other company but to me they do seem different-ish. They are also being sold at different price points and I’m assuming materials so this to me is already a different market.
